This is a standard Ballantine's whisky in a ceramic jug as sold from the 1960's through to the mid 1990's. Looking at the printing I would reckon it dates from around the late 70's to mid 80's, the style of print changed about 4 times over the 40 years it was sold and is a good indication. It should be in an outer blue and cream carton and the jug shoud be sealed with a red plastic embossed seal.

I doubt there's any real value to it as there were many millions sold, just the intrinsic value of the whisky
